Skip to content

Commit 08811c0

Browse files
lumagrobclark
authored andcommitted
drm/msm/dsi: dsi_phy_28nm_8960: fix uninitialized variable access
The parent_name initialization was lost in refactoring, restore it now. Fixes: 5d13459 ("drm/msm/dsi: push provided clocks handling into a generic code") Reported-by: kernel test robot <lkp@intel.com>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org> Reviewed-by: Abhinav Kumar <abhinavk@codeaurora.org> Link: https://lore.kernel.org/r/20210410011901.1735866-1-dmitry.baryshkov@linaro.org Signed-off-by: Rob Clark <robdclark@chromium.org>
1 parent 4b95d37 commit 08811c0

1 file changed

Lines changed: 4 additions & 0 deletions

File tree

drivers/gpu/drm/msm/dsi/phy/dsi_phy_28nm_8960.c

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-405,6 +405,10 @@ static int pll_28nm_register(struct dsi_pll_28nm *pll_28nm, struct clk_hw **prov
405405
if (!vco_name)
406406
return -ENOMEM;
407407

408+
parent_name = devm_kzalloc(dev, 32, GFP_KERNEL);
409+
if (!parent_name)
410+
return -ENOMEM;
411+
408412
clk_name = devm_kzalloc(dev, 32, GFP_KERNEL);
409413
if (!clk_name)
410414
return -ENOMEM;

0 commit comments

Comments
 (0)